What Rosemont code requires

Replacing a water heater in Rosemont follows California rules under the California Plumbing Code (based on the Uniform Plumbing Code, UPC). Here’s what applies statewide:

  • Permit

    Pulled by your licensed plumber; covers gas/venting and the expansion tank.

    Required
  • Seismic strapping

    State code requires seismic strapping on water heater replacements — budget for it on every quote.

    Required
  • Expansion tank

    Required where a pressure regulator or backflow preventer is present.

    Required on closed plumbing systems
  • Plumbing code
    California Plumbing Code (based on the Uniform Plumbing Code, UPC)
  • Good to know

    State law (Health & Safety Code 19211) requires water heaters to be braced/strapped at the upper and lower one-third points to resist earthquake displacement.

What moves the price

What affects water heater replacement cost in Rosemont?

The age of your home (median 1976) may require plumbing or venting updates, adding to labor costs. Unit type is a major factor: heat pump models are more expensive upfront but qualify for the federal 25C tax credit (30% up to $2,000). Tankless units also cost more due to installation complexity. Permit fees and seismic strapping compliance are mandatory and vary by local jurisdiction. Finally, mild Mediterranean winters mean moderate inlet water temperatures, which can slightly improve efficiency for heat pump units.

Common water heater issues in Rosemont

1

Sediment buildup

Hard water in the region can cause sediment accumulation, reducing efficiency and lifespan.

2

Corrosion from age

Homes built in 1976 often have older water heaters that may develop leaks due to tank corrosion.

3

Seismic strapping compliance

California law requires water heaters to be braced at the upper and lower one-third points to prevent earthquake displacement.
